I have a basic digital compact and use a string tripod to avoid camera
shake.
I usually loop the string round the back of my neck but most advice sites
suggest standing on the string.
Is one of these better than the other for reducing shake?
Don't know about better, but what used to be called chain-pods were
once manufactured commercially. I carried one for years; you'd stand on
one end and pull up on the camera. Chain being more rigid than string,
and the floor being steadier than your neck.
